Output d3ca7890641b14ed1595a9014c7999773f6de2b47155015bde5f60bf74774acc:0
- value
- 512932
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8438adc50cabd53ec8e9a3ea9bb61c479cd313c5 OP_EQUAL
- address
- 3Dk91ybXhEMdNpiLbYJK3vNpHSqemLUbGs
- transaction
- d3ca7890641b14ed1595a9014c7999773f6de2b47155015bde5f60bf74774acc
- confirmations
- 119257
- spent
- true